Birrung Gallery is a World Vision Australia initiative that provides
unique Indigenous artwork to collectors and art lovers around the world.
Through the sale of fine arts, Birrung Gallery raises funds for
Indigenous community development, including employment training at our
Sydney gallery, scholarships for Indigenous students and preventative
health, social, cultural, economic and governance activities in rural
and remote Australia.
Birrung also advocates for the rights of Indigenous artists through
such avenues as the 2007 Senate Inquiry in to the Indigenous Arts
Industry and the national Code of Conduct for commercial galleries
currently being developed by the Federal Government.
We represent over 400 Indigenous artists and 25 remote communities from across Australia.
